The Asia Pacific Ethyl Butyrate Market was valued at USD 87.4 Million in 2024 and is projected to reach USD 112.6 Million by 2032, growing at a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 4.3% during the forecast period (2025–2032). This growth is being driven by booming food processing industries, rising demand for natural flavor enhancers in emerging economies, and the accelerating adoption of bio-based ethyl butyrate solutions across food, beverage, fragrance, and pharmaceutical sectors.

🌍 Outlook: The Future of Asia Pacific Ethyl Butyrate Is Natural and Sustainable

The Asia Pacific ethyl butyrate market is undergoing a dynamic shift. While synthetic variants still hold volume sway, the industry is investing heavily in bio-based alternatives, green production technologies, and expanded flavor applications.

📈 Key Trends Shaping the Market:

  • Rapid bio-production capacity growth in China, Japan, and ASEAN
  • Regulatory mandates for natural flavors up to 10% by 2030
  • Digital supply chains and traceability for clean-label compliance
  • Flavor house alliances for e-liquids and vegan products
